O Que São Dados Estruturados
Dados estruturados são informações organizadas em formato tabular ou hierárquico, com rótulos e padrões definidos que permitem que máquinas leiam, interpretem e processem esses dados de forma eficiente e previsível. Ao contrário dos dados não estruturados, que podem vir de textos livres, imagens ou vídeos, os dados estruturados seguem um modelo rigoroso, como tabelas, bases de dados relacionais ou arquivos com delimitadores, onde cada coluna e linha têm um significado claro. Na prática, isso significa que cada campo tem um nome, um tipo de dado e, muitas vezes, relações estabelecidas com outros conjuntos de dados, o que possibilita desde buscas simples até análises complexas e algoritmos de machine learning.
Como funcionam os dados estruturados e quais são suas características principais
Os dados estruturados funcionam ao serem organizados em estruturas formais que facilitam a armazenagem, o acesso e a manipulação. Essas estruturas normalmente seguem um esquema pré-definido, que pode ser expresso em linguagens como SQL ou em formatos como CSV, JSON (quando com chaves e arrays bem organizados) ou até mesmo em planilhas bem delimitadas. Dentre as principais características, destacam-se:
- Organização formal: os campos seguem um padrão rígido, com tipos de dados definidos (texto, número, data, booleano, etc.).
- Consistência: registros semelhantes têm a mesma estrutura, o que reduz ambiguidades e facilita a validação.
- Facilidade de consulta: é possível usar linguagens de consulta poderosas, como SQL, para extrair, filtrar e agregar informações rapidamente.
- Escalabilidade bem comportada: em arquiteturas de banco de dados relacionais, é possível otimizar o acesso por meio de índices, particionamento e normalização.
- Interoperabilidade: sistemas distintos conseguem trocar e integrar dados estruturados quando adotam padrões comuns, como schemas bem documentados.
Por que os dados estruturados são fundamentais para análise de dados e inteligência artificial
A importância dos dados estruturados vai muito além da organização visual em planilhas. Na análise de dados, eles constituem a base para relatórios, dashboards e métricas de performance, pois garantem que as variáveis sejam comparáveis ao longo do tempo e entre diferentes fontes. Em projetos de inteligência artificial e machine learning, a qualidade e a estrutura dos dados de entrada são cruciais: algoritmos supervisionados, por exemplo, dependem de features bem definidas, rotuladas e consistentes para treinar modelos confiáveis. Sem uma base estruturada, torna-se difícil generalizar padrões, validar resultados ou explicar as decisões de um modelo, especialmente em contextos regulados.
Quais são os exemplos mais comuns de dados estruturados no dia a dia
Na prática, convivemos com dados estruturados em diversas situações, muitas vezes sem perceber. Alguns exemplos típicos incluem:
- Planilhas eletrônicas: arquivos como Excel ou Google Sheets, onde linhas representam registros e colunas representam atributos (nome, idade, valor, data).
- Bancos de dados relacionais: tabelas em sistemas como MySQL, PostgreSQL, SQL Server e Oracle, com chaves primárias, estrangeiras e relações bem definidas.
- Arquivos CSV e JSON estruturados: usados em exportações de sistemas, APIs bem definidas e trocas de dados entre aplicações.
- Sistemas ERP e CRM: módulos de vendas, estoque, finanças e recursos humanos, que armazenam informações em entidades normalizadas.
- Registros de transações: extratos bancários, notas fiscais e logs de auditoria, quando mantidos em formatos padronizados.
Quais são os desafios e limitações dos dados estruturados
Apesar das vantagens, a dependência excessiva de dados estruturados também traz desafios. A rigidez do esquema pode dificultar a adaptação a mudanças rápidas nos requisitos, exigindo migrações caras e trabalhosas. Além disso, a normalização extrema pode gerar complexidade nas consultas, exigindo joins custosos em grandes volumes de dados. Em alguns cenários, especialmente com fontes heterogêneas ou com alta variabilidade, a modelagem puramente estruturada pode ser lenta demais ou até inviável, levando organizações a adotarem abordagens híbridas, combinando armazenamento estruturado com flexibilidade semiestruturada.
Como transformar informações não estruturadas em dados estruturados
Uma dúvida comum é se é possível tirar proveito de informações que não nascem estruturadas. A resposta é afirmativa, mas demanda esforço de engenharia de dados. Processos como ETL (Extract, Transform, Load) e ELT são usados para extrair dados de fontes variadas, limpá-los, aplicar regras de negócio e carregar em estruturas tabulares ou de data warehouse. Técnicas de NLP (processamento natural de linguagem), regex e ferramentas de limpeza ajudam a converter textos livres, e-mails, imagens (com OCR) e áudios em campos discretos, permitindo que esses ativos passem a fazer parte de bancos de dados e relatórios estruturados.

Quais são as melhores práticas para trabalhar com dados estruturados
Para maximizar os benefícios e minimizar riscos, siga algumas diretrizes consolidadas:
- Projete com antecedência: defina um schema claro, com tipos de dado, restrições de nulidade e chaves primárias bem identificadas.
- Normalize adequadamente: evite redundâncias desnecessárias, mas balanceie com o desempenho das consultas.
- Documente tudo: mantenha dicionário de dados e metadados que expliquent o significado de cada coluna e relacionamento.
- Valide na entrada: garanta que os dados que entram no sistema estejam de acordo com as regras de negócio desde o início.
- Monitore e versione: acompanhe mudanças no schema e use controle de versão para esquemas, especialmente em times ágeis.
- Otimize consultas: use índices estrategicamente, evite selects desnecessários e considere particionamento para grandes volumes.
Quais são as diferenças entre dados estruturados, semiestruturados e não estruturados
Entender a matriz de dados ajuda a escolher as ferramentas certas. Enquanto os dados estruturados têm um formato rígido e organizacionalmente fechado, os semiestruturados (como JSON, XML ou YAML) oferecem flexibilidade com hierarquia, mas ainda podem ser parseados por máquinas. Os não estruturados, por sua vez, carecem de um modelo predefinido — são textos longos, imagens, vídeos e áudios, que demandam técnicas avançadas de processamento para serem transformados em informação útil. Em arquiteturas modernas, costuma-se usar esses três tipos em combinação, aproveitando o rigor dos primeiros para garantir consistência e a agilidade dos segundos e terceiros para inovação.
O que são dados estruturados: perguntas frequentes
Abaixo, você encontra respostas para as dúvidas mais frequentes sobre o tema.

O que são dados estruturados em nuvem
Dados estruturados em nuvem são armazenados e processados por serviços de computação em larga escala, como Amazon RDS, Google Cloud SQL ou Azure SQL Database. Esses serviços oferecem alta disponibilidade, backup automatizado e dimensionamento sob demanda, mantendo a rigidez estruturada enquanto eliminam a necessidade de infraestrutura física própria.
Dados estruturados vs não estruturados: qual é a diferença
A principal diferença está na organização. Dados estruturados seguem um esquema fixo, o que os torna altamente consultáveis e ideais para transações e relatórios. Já os não estruturados não têm um formato predefinido, exigindo técnicas de análise mais avançadas, como mineração de texto ou visão computacional, mas oferecem riqueza contextual que muitas vezes os torna indispensáveis.
É possível transformar não estruturado em estruturado
Sim, é possível e bastante comum. Com técnicas de engenharia de dados, como ETL, NLP e OCR, é possível extrair informações de e-mails, documentos, imagens e áudis, convertendo-os em tabelas com colunas como data, autor, assunto, sentimento ou texto resumido. Esse processo costuma ser essencial para alimentar data warehouses e algoritmos de machine learning.

Por que os dados estruturados são importantes para SEO
Na internet, esquemas estruturados (também chamados de markup de dados estruturados) ajudam mecanismos de busca a entenderem melhor o conteúdo de uma página. Ao marcar informações como produtos, avaliações, eventos ou receitas com vocabulários controlados, você fornece pistas claras aos robôs, o que pode melhorar a relevância, exibir rich snippets e aumentar a clicabilidade nos resultados de busca.
Quais são os riscos de usar apenas dados estruturados
A rigidez pode ser dupla faca: enquanto garante qualidade e performance, também pode excluir insights que estejam em padrões menos óbvios ou em fontes não convencionais. Dados comportamentais de cliques, sentimentos em redes sociais ou feedbacks em áudio, muitas vezes não cabem bem em schemas rígidos. Por isso, arquiteturas híbridas, que combinam armazenamento estruturado com capacidades para semiestruturado e não estruturado, são cada vez mais populares.